### Account Recovery — Catalogue Import (Lintwood)

Quick one for review: when the Lintwood catalogue import wipes a patron's session table, the recovery flow re-seeds accounts from the nightly snapshot. Check that the importer skips locked accounts — last time it didn't. To rerun recovery against staging you'll need the vault passphrase, which is appended just below.

recovery phrase for yafof-tajof: julmir-kelax-julvan-holath-belvan-holir-ralael-ralvan-ralath-julvan-silmir-istmir-kaswyn-ulamir

**Ticket PKT-88: Webhook fires twice on parcel handoff**

For whoever inherits this: the Cartwheel parcel-tracking webhook double-fires when a package moves from the Delven hub to a courier within the same minute. Downstream, Merrow's notifier then texts customers twice. Root cause looks like a missing idempotency check in the handoff event coalescer. Repro steps attached. The offending deploy is identified by the token below.

trace token, hawep-hadug: htk3_9c2

We are separating the Brindlecore device fleet into stable and early-access firmware channels. Current state: all devices pull from a single channel, so a bad build reaches every unit at once. This change introduces channel tags in the provisioning record, a staged rollout policy of 5/25/100 percent, and an automatic halt on elevated crash telemetry. Contractors: please test channel reassignment on bench devices only, never on customer units. This ticket cannot ship until sign-off is recorded by the engineer named below.

signatory, tahop-taweg: Pelmir Oliys